Those older Cat stators used to go out at about 5000+ miles I believe. That drove me crazy, it would fire up fine ( cold ) then as soon as I got to the farmers field it would back fire,missfire, fire on one then another ect... I dragged it out of the field 3 times and pulled the carbs 3 times before I figured that 1 out.

I had the same problem with a '94 T-Cat. The first tip the stator was bad was the "always dim headlight" no matter how much you reved it. I had the same problem with fouling plugs and carb cleaning and fuel delivery. The sled was a nightmare. Dealer quoted me big bucks to replace stator and I sold it instead.
